Laptops donated to upskill homeless people in Salford

School of Science, Engineering and Environment

The Â׸£ÀûƬ has donated 60 laptops to a local charity to help upskill homeless people. Emmaus Salford supports people who have been homeless by providing them with a place to stay, and with meaningful work in a community setting.

Claims for housing issues on the rise, due to unsafe living conditions and cost of living crisis

Salford Business School

Legal claims for housing-related matters are on the rise, according to data from Â׸£ÀûƬ Business School’s pro bono community legal advice service, SILKS Law Clinic, which has seen an 18% rise in cases to-date this year.
